There is not one but various ways to solve equations easily however the easiest one is elimination method. In it, we eliminate one term to find out the value of other term and then substitute the resulting value in one of the given equation. However, for this method, we need minimum two equations that are subtracted from each other to get the values. Here is the brief concept of solving equations. Elimination method when no multiplication is required When there are two variables in an equation, then we need to isolate any term or use inverse operations to get the number or variable alone. So, let’s understand it with an example 2x – y = -8 and 2x + 2y = 6. Note: keep in mind that while using elimination method signs of the number gets inverse, i.e., negative become positive and vice versa. 2x – y = -8 (-) (2x + 2y = 6) ______________________ (-y) = (-2) Both the minus signs get canceled, and then we get the value of y=2. Elimination method when multiplication is required To inverse terms, sometimes we need to make one variable of both the terms equal so that it gets canceled easily. While solving equations, we tend to multiply both the equations like this: For example 2x – y = 4 and 3x + y = -2 (2x – y = 4)(3) Becomes 6x + 3y = 12 (3x + y = -2)(2) Becomes 6x + 2y = -4 So, here we solve equation the resulting equation: 6x + 3y = 12 (-) (6x + 2y = -4) _________________ y = 16 Important points to be considered while solving equations by elimination method: Take care about signs Signs are the most crucial aspect of equations so consider signs carefully. Along with this, you should have proper knowledge about sign combinations. Like tow minus signs are equal to plus i.e. (-,-=+), (-, +=-), (+,-=-) and (+, +=+). Inverse operations Inverse operations are required in this method as we have to make one variable alone to get the value of another variable. While going for such operations, consider proper signs and numbers for getting the solution right. There is one important tip as isolate consonant to make the variable alone. Substitute values Without substituting values, you can’t get the value of both variables. Also, if you have multiplied the equation to make it inverse then never put the value in the multiplied equation. One needs to put the value in that equation which is organic, i.e., not multiplied.
